緊急ウェブサイト・スケーリング・ソリューション:ウェブサイトを拡張するための実践的ガイド

緊急ウェブサイト・スケーリング・ソリューション:ウェブサイトを拡張するための実践的ガイド

目まぐるしく変化するデジタルの世界において、ウェブサイトは多くの企業にとって生命線であり、顧客との主要な接点となっています。しかし、予期せぬトラフィックの急増や技術的な不具合により、ウェブサイトが大きなプレッシャーにさらされ、売上の損失やユーザーの不満につながる可能性があります。このような重要な瞬間にウェブサイトを迅速かつ効率的に拡張する方法を知っておくことは、サービスの継続性を維持するために不可欠です。このガイドでは、予期せぬ需要の急増を効果的に管理し、オンラインプレゼンスを堅牢で応答性の高いものにするための実践的な戦略をご紹介します。小規模なブログであれ、大規模なeコマースプラットフォームであれ、これらの緊急スケーリングテクニックを理解することで、緊急事態や効果的なスケーリングに対応できるようになり、どのような状況でもサイトを円滑に運営できるようになります。

よくある質問

In an emergency, the quickest way to scale your website is often not to rebuild infrastructure on the fly but to control demand before it reaches the stack. Queue-Fair does exactly that by placing a Virtual Waiting Room in front of your site, and for many websites and apps it can be deployed with a single line of code in about five minutes, with a Free Queue option available—a major advantage for enterprise organisations that need to get back up and running fast. Use services like AWS Elastic Beanstalk, Google Cloud App Engine, or Azure App Service, which automatically add or remove resources based on real-time demand. Implement a Content Delivery Network (CDN) such as Cloudflare or Akamai to cache static assets and distribute traffic globally, reducing load on your origin server. Optimize your web application for performance by minimizing large files, enabling compression, and using efficient caching strategies for both static and dynamic content.

ロードバランサーをセットアップして、複数のサーバーに均等にリクエストを分散させ、単一のサーバーがボトルネックになるのを防ぐ。読み取りレプリカや自動スケーリングを提供するマネージド・データベース・サービスを利用するか、データをシャーディングすることで、データベースのスケーラビリティを確保する。Datadog、New Relic、または組み込みのクラウド監視ソリューションなどのツールを使用して、主要メトリクス(CPU、メモリ、ネットワーク・トラフィック、応答時間)を監視し、問題にリアルタイムで対応できるようにする。

レート制限、キューイング、または極端な急増時に静的な「お待ちください」ページを表示することにより、高負荷時にアプリケーションが優雅に劣化するように準備します。JMeterやLocustのようなツールで定期的にインフラストラクチャのストレステストを行い、ボトルネックを特定し、スケーリング戦略が意図したとおりに機能することを確認する。最後に、停電や速度低下時にユーザーに最新情報を提供するためのコミュニケーションプランを準備し、ホスティングプロバイダーと協力して、緊急時にリソースの上限を迅速に増やせるようにしましょう。

If your website starts crashing due to overwhelming user demand, the first priority is to stabilise the experience immediately rather than let every visitor keep hammering the origin. Queue-Fair can do that fast by holding visitors in an orderly virtual queue, and for many sites it takes only a single line of code and about five minutes to deploy, which is why it is so useful for enterprise incident response. First, notify your hosting provider or technical team immediately—they may be able to temporarily scale resources or identify the source of the bottleneck. If you use a cloud hosting service, consider upgrading your plan or enabling auto-scaling to handle increased traffic. Implement a content delivery network (CDN) to distribute traffic and reduce load on your main server. Temporarily disable non-essential features or plugins that consume high resources. If possible, activate a maintenance mode or a static landing page to keep users informed while you address the issue. Monitor server logs and analytics to pinpoint specific causes of the crash, such as spikes from a particular region or page. Optimize your website’s code and database queries to improve performance. Consider load balancing if you expect continued high demand, which distributes traffic across multiple servers. Communicate transparently with your users via social media or email about the issue and expected resolution time. After the immediate crisis, conduct a post-mortem to identify long-term solutions, such as optimizing infrastructure, improving caching, and preparing for future traffic surges. Regularly stress-test your website to ensure it can handle peak loads. By taking these steps, you can restore service quickly, maintain user trust, and prevent similar issues in the future.

When an unexpected surge in visitors hits, the most effective tools are the ones that buy you stability immediately, and that usually means a Virtual Waiting Room rather than more infrastructure alone. Queue-Fair gives enterprise organisations that rapid control—often with a single line of code, about five minutes to go live, and a Free Queue option—while the wider hosting, CDN, and database layers are being scaled and tuned behind the scenes. Content Delivery Networks (CDNs) like Cloudflare, Akamai, and Amazon CloudFront distribute your content across global servers, reducing load on your origin server and speeding up delivery to users. Cloud hosting providers such as Amazon Web Services (AWS), Google Cloud Platform (GCP), and Microsoft Azure offer auto-scaling features that automatically add or remove server resources based on real-time traffic demands. Load balancers, available through these cloud platforms or as standalone solutions like NGINX and HAProxy, distribute incoming traffic across multiple servers to prevent any single server from becoming overwhelmed.

WordPressサイト向けのWP EngineやKinstaのようなマネージドホスティングサービスは、高トラフィックイベントに合わせた組み込みのスケーラビリティとパフォーマンスの最適化を提供する。AWS LambdaやGoogle Cloud Functionsのようなサーバーレスアーキテクチャは、イベントに応じてコードを実行することで突然のスパイクに対応し、サーバー管理の必要なく自動的にスケーリングすることができます。New RelicやDatadogのようなアプリケーション・パフォーマンス・モニタリング(APM)ツールは、トラフィック急増時のボトルネックの迅速な特定と解決に役立ちます。

eコマースやダイナミックなWebアプリケーションの場合は、読み取り用レプリカを備えたAmazon RDSや、読み取り/書き込み操作の増加に対応できるMongoDB AtlasのようなマネージドNoSQLデータベースなどのデータベース・スケーリング・ソリューションの利用をご検討ください。これらのツールやサービスを組み合わせることで、予期せぬトラフィックの急増に迅速に対応できる弾力性のあるインフラを構築し、サイトが最も重要なときに高速で利用可能な状態を維持することができます。



G2とSourceForgeで最高評価のバーチャル待合室
使いやすさNo.1。5.0/5つ星のパーフェクトスコアです。すべての指標でナンバー2のサプライヤーに勝っています。

お客様の

 

ユーザーニーズの特定とステークホルダーのコラボレーション

緊急対応では、利用者のニーズを理解することが、効果的でタイムリーなサービスを提供するための基礎となる。一刻を争う状況では、救急サービス、ソーシャル・ケア提供者、コミュニティ組織などの関係者間の協力が不可欠となる。これらのチームが協力することで、利用者が何を必要としているかを共通理解し、的を絞った効率的な支援を行うことができる。

この協力関係の重要な部分は、データ共有協定の作成である。これらの協定により、プライバシーとコンプライアンスを維持しながら、医療記録や緊急連絡先などの機密データや情報を安全に共有することができる。例えば、自然災害時には、データ共有協定によって、緊急対応要員が重要な情報に迅速にアクセスできるようになり、必要な人々に適切な支援を提供できるようになる。

ユーザーのニーズに優先順位をつけ、関係者の強力なコラボレーションを促進することで、緊急対応チームは効果的で安全なソリューションを開発することができます。このアプローチは、提供されるサービスの質を向上させるだけでなく、リソースの効率的な利用を保証し、最終的には危機の際に真の違いを生み出します。

サーバーの負荷限界の評価

サーバーの負荷限界を評価するには、現在のインフラが処理できるトラフィック量を把握することが重要です。そのためには、さまざまな条件下でのサーバーのパフォーマンスを調べる必要があります。

  1. サーバー使用状況の監視:CPU、メモリ、帯域幅の使用状況を定期的にチェックし、典型的な負荷パターンを把握する。サーバーリソースの管理を維持することは、特に負荷のピーク時に最適なパフォーマンスを確保するために不可欠です。

  2. 負荷テストの実施:ツールを使ってトラフィックをシミュレートし、ストレス下でのサーバーのパフォーマンスを測定します。

  3. 結果の分析負荷のピーク時間と潜在的な弱点を特定する。

サーバーの上限を把握することで、いつ、どのように規模を拡大するかについて、十分な情報に基づいた決定を下すことができ、トラフィックのピーク時の安定性を確保できます。

交通パターンの分析

トラフィックパターンを分析することで、いつ、なぜスパイクが発生するのかについての洞察が得られ、より適切な予測と準備が可能になる。

まず、過去のトラフィックデータを見直すことから始める。季節的な増加や定期的なピーク時などの傾向を探す。これは、将来的なスパイクの可能性を特定するのに役立ちます。

次に、トラフィックソースを細分化する。ソーシャルメディアからのトラフィックなのか、検索エンジンからのトラフィックなのか、それとも直接の訪問なのかを理解することで、規模拡大戦略を調整することができる。

最後に、より深い洞察を得るために分析ツールの利用を検討しましょう。これらのツールは訪問者の行動を追跡し、どこでボトルネックが発生しているかを示すことができます。これらのツールでレポート作成を自動化することで、時間を節約し、正確性を確保し、トラフィック急増時の意思決定をサポートすることができます。この分析は、プロアクティブなスケーリングに不可欠です。

ボトルネックの特定

ボトルネックを特定することは、トラフィック急増時にウェブサイトを円滑に運営するために非常に重要です。これらのボトルネックはパフォーマンスを低下させ、ユーザーエクスペリエンスに影響を与えます。

サーバーの応答時間をチェックすることから始めましょう。レスポンスが遅いということは、リクエスト処理に潜在的な問題があることを示しています。データベースのクエリ、サーバーの処理、ネットワークの遅延などです。

リソースの割り当てを見直す。CPUやメモリなどのリソースが、同時リクエストを処理するために適切に配分されていることを確認する。

最後に、パフォーマンス・モニタリング・ツールを使用して、ボトルネックを継続的に追跡・特定する。このリアルタイムのデータは、必要な調整を迅速に行うのに役立つ。

スケーラブルなソリューションの導入

トラフィックの急増時にパフォーマンスを維持するには、スケーラブルなソリューションの導入が不可欠です。これには、需要に応じて成長し、信頼性とアクセシビリティを確保できる技術と戦略を使用することが必要です。スケーラブルなソリューションは、多くの場合、サービス開発を合理化し、チーム間の一貫性を促進する共有コンポーネントを確立することによって、緊急ウェブサイトのスケーリングの課題に対処するために開発および作成されます。

機密データの保護とコンプライアンスの徹底

個人情報や機密情報の取り扱いが日常化する緊急対応において、機密データの保護は最優先事項です。リスクを最小限に抑え、GDPRやDPA Pt3のような規制へのコンプライアンスを確保するため、チームは業務のあらゆる段階で強固なセキュリティ対策を実施する必要があります。

セキュアなクラウドサービスの利用は、突然の需要急増に対応するために必要な柔軟性を維持しながら、機密データを保護するための実用的な方法です。クラウドサービスはスケーラブルなインフラを提供するため、チームはセキュリティを犠牲にすることなく、ニーズの変化に迅速に対応することができます。さらに、暗号化と厳格なアクセス制御により、機密情報へのアクセスを許可された担当者のみに限定することができます。

例えば、大規模な緊急事態が発生した場合、クラウドベースのシステムは、機密データの安全性とコンプライアンスを維持しながら、サービスの迅速な展開をサポートすることができます。データ保護と法規制の遵守に重点を置くことで、緊急対応チームはデータ漏洩のリスクを低減するだけでなく、高圧的な状況下で効果的なサービスを提供するために不可欠な要素である社会的信頼も構築することができる。

プロトタイピング、テスト、プロセスの自動化

緊急対応ではスピードと効率が重要であり、そこでプロトタイピング、テスト、プロセスの自動化が威力を発揮する。緊急対応システムのプロトタイプを作成し、シミュレーション環境で厳密にテストすることで、チームは実際の事故が発生する前に弱点を特定し、ワークフローを最適化することができる。

自動化もまた、緊急活動を改善するための強力なツールである。データ入力や報告などの日常業務を自動化することで、人的ミスのリスクを軽減し、貴重なリソースをより緊急性の高い活動に振り向けることができる。たとえば、大規模な事故が発生した場合、自動化されたシステムは大量のデータをリアルタイムで処理し、対応担当者に最新の知見を提供する。

アクセシビリティとユーザー・エクスペリエンスに重点を置くことも同様に重要です。プレッシャーのかかる状況下でも直感的に使いやすいシステムを設計することで、チームはサポートを最も必要とする人々に迅速かつ効果的に届けることができます。最終的には、テクノロジーと自動化を活用することで、緊急対応チームはプロセスを合理化し、リスクを低減し、ユーザーにより良い結果をもたらすことができる。

クラウドベースのホスティングオプション

クラウドベースのホスティングは、従来のホスティングには欠けていた柔軟性と拡張性を提供します。需要に応じてリソースを調整することができます。

無料のクラウド・ホスティング・ソリューションもあり、コストを削減するのに役立つが、ニーズが変化した場合や、無料層が制限されるようになった場合に移行する計画を立てておくことが重要だ。

クラウド・ソリューションを活用することで、企業はリソースをリアルタイムのニーズに合わせて、効率的かつコスト効率よく拡張することができる。

コンテンツ・デリバリー・ネットワーク

コンテンツ・デリバリー・ネットワーク(CDN)は、コンテンツを複数の場所に分散することで、ウェブサイトのパフォーマンスを向上させます。これにより、トラフィックの急増を効果的に管理することができます。

CDNを導入することで、トラフィックの多い時間帯のユーザーエクスペリエンスを大幅に向上させることができます。技術パートナーと協力することで、CDNの展開とパフォーマンスをさらに最適化できます。

負荷分散のテクニック

ロードバランシングは、受信トラフィックを複数のサーバーに分散させ、1つのサーバーに負担がかからないようにするために重要です。

  1. ラウンドロビン:リクエストをサーバー間で順次分散し、負荷を均等に分散する。

  2. 最小接続数:アクティブな接続が最も少ないサーバーにトラフィックを誘導します。

  3. IPハッシュ:クライアントIPに基づいてリクエストを割り当て、セッションの永続性を確保する。

ロードバランシングの実装は、緊急ウェブサイト・スケーリング・ソリューションの中で重要なプロジェクトとして扱われるべきです。これらの技術は、リソースの使用を最適化し、トラフィック急増時の応答時間を改善します。

モニタリングと調整

継続的なモニタリングと調整は、緊急時にサイトのパフォーマンスを維持するために不可欠である。これにはリアルタイムの追跡、自動化ツール、事後の分析が含まれる。また、モニタリングと調整のプロセスを通じて、公式ガイダンスやベストプラクティスに従うことも、効果的でコンプライアンスに準拠した対応を確保するために重要である。

リアルタイム・パフォーマンス追跡

リアルタイム・パフォーマンス・トラッキングにより、ウェブサイトの健全性を継続的に監視することができます。これにより、発生した問題を特定し、対処することができます。

リアルタイムのトラッキングにより、トラフィック急増時にも最適なパフォーマンスを維持するための迅速な対応が可能です。

自動スケーリングツール

自動スケーリングツールは、トラフィック需要に基づいてリソースを動的に調整し、一貫したパフォーマンスを保証します。

これらのツールは、予期せぬトラフィックの増加に対応する効率性と信頼性を提供します。あらゆる規模の組織が自動スケーリング・ツールを活用することで、突然の需要急増時にもシステムが応答性と回復力を維持できるようになります。

緊急事態後の分析

緊急事態の後、事後分析を行うことは、何がうまくいき、どこに改善が必要かを理解するために極めて重要である。

徹底的な文書化と分析により、緊急ウェブサイト・スケーリング・ソリューションの有効性を実証することが重要です。この分析は、将来の戦略を洗練させ、同様の状況に対する準備態勢を向上させるのに役立ちます。

ベストプラクティスと将来への備え

ベストプラクティスを採用し、将来の課題に備えることで、ウェブサイトのトラフィック急増を長期的に管理することができます。これには、計画の策定、インフラの改善、過去の経験からの学習が含まれます。このようなプラクティスを採用するメリットには、信頼性の向上、レスポンスタイムの短縮、ウェブサイトの緊急拡張時の耐障害性の向上などがあります。

対応計画の策定

対応計画を策定することで、緊急事態が発生したときにチームが何をすべきかを正確に把握することができます。これにより、混乱を減らし、対応時間を短縮することができます。

文書化された計画は、不測の事態が発生した際に迅速かつ効果的な行動をとるために不可欠である。

継続的なインフラ改善

将来への備えには、継続的なインフラの改善が不可欠である。これには、変化する需要に対応するために、定期的に技術や慣行を更新することが含まれる。

インフラを常に更新することで、ウェブサイトが将来のトラフィック急増に効果的に対応できるようになります。

過去の事件から学ぶ

過去の事故から学ぶことは、緊急対応戦略を洗練させるために極めて重要である。それぞれの出来事から、何がうまくいき、何がうまくいかなかったかについての貴重な洞察を得ることができる。

継続的に学習し、適応することで、あなたのビジネスは将来の課題によりよく備えることができる。



当社のキュー・ソリューションは、何千もの大手企業から信頼を得ています。

Customer 1
Customer 2
Customer 3
Customer 4
Customer 5
Customer 6

Queue-Fair - インターネットの緊急サービス